Abstract The Activation Strain Model (ASM) and Energy Decomposition Analysis (EDA) are fundamental methodologies rooted in and augmenting the Kohn Sham Molecular Orbital (KS-MO) Theory for understanding reactivity and diverse chemical phenomena. Their combined use allows the unraveling of the causal physical factors underlying the chemical phenomena of interest. These methods are based on the decomposition of the electronic energy along a reaction path into physically meaningful terms related to the deformations and interactions that occur along that path. In this project, we aim to employ the ASM in combination with the EDA to investigate two chemical processes. The first process is the competition between SN1 and SN2 nucleophilic substitution reactions, in which we will perform a systematic study on the effect of varying the nucleophiles, leaving groups, substrates, and reaction solvents. In the second research topic, we aim to extend the molecular orbital model for aromaticity developed by Prof. Dr. Matthias Bickelhaupt to a range of heterocyclic and inorganic benzene and cyclobutadiene analogs. In this context, acquiring in-depth knowledge and proficiency in the principles and application of ASM and EDA methodologies would be of fundamental importance for the candidate, as these two methodologies will certainly be useful in the original Ph.D. project. | |
